In this review of the WHITIN Men's Minimalist Trail Runner, the bottom line is simple: these are trail shoes for men who want a near-barefoot feel with more protection and a roomy front for natural toe splay. The reviewer found the single biggest reason to buy is the wide toe box, which consistently improves comfort on long walks and runs by letting toes spread and reducing hot spots. For runners who prioritize ground feedback and light weight while keeping a protective rubber sole, this shoe delivers a strong combination of feel and functionality.
Key Features
- Wide toe box: Allows toes to spread and relax, which reduces pressure and improves stability on uneven trails.
- Barefoot inspired sole: The true rubber sole gives reliable protection while still allowing good ground feedback for better proprioception.
- Animal free construction: Made using animal free products and processes, appealing to shoppers seeking vegan-friendly footwear.
- Removable sockliner: The insole can be removed to increase the barefoot sensation for those who want an even lower profile.
- Lightweight design: Customers report a weight that supports long treadmill walks and trail days without feeling cumbersome.
Who It's For
These trail runners suit men who want a minimalist shoe that still offers some protection on rough ground. They are a good fit for light to moderate trail running, hiking, and everyday use where a natural toe spread and ground feel are priorities; the removable sockliner lets users tune the level of barefoot sensation.
Shoppers who want heavy cushioning, maximalist support, or long-lasting, rugged mountaineering boots should look elsewhere. Some buyers have reported seam issues over time, so those needing extreme durability for multi-year heavy use may prefer more reinforced trail models.
Pros & Cons
Pros
- Comfortable wide toe box that reduces toe crowding and improves fit.
- True rubber sole balances protection with ground feedback for a barefoot inspired feel.
- Lightweight and versatile for treadmill sessions, trail runs, and daily wear.
- Vegan-friendly construction using animal free products and processes.
Cons
- Some users report seam durability issues, so longevity may vary with heavy use.
- If between sizes, customers are advised to order the next size down, which can complicate sizing choices.
